The Ossila Dip Coater’s wide working base means that larger beakers (up to 2 litres in size) can be used. As the movement distance of the arm is 110mm, you can coat substrates over 10cm in length.

User Manual Crash-Detection Switch The Dip Coater is fitted with an inbuilt crash-detection switch. The crash-detection switch is housed within the connection between the mounting arm and stage (see Figure 3.1). During normal operation, the safety switch will remain in a constant ‘ON’ state, with the bar attached to the motor pressing against the switch.

User Manual Operational Safety Any procedure that is done with the dip coater should be carried out with a suitable operating procedure, risk assessment, and COSHH forms to ensure that the user knows and understands the potential hazards inherent to the system of work they are undertaking. The following are safety points that should be noted by the user before any procedure is undertaken with the dip coater.
